WebMar 25, 2010 · DIY Vertical Brick BBQ Smoker Here, as follows, are some general instructions and explanations of how I built my vertical brick BBQ smoker. It wasn’t very hard to do, it cost me only about $200, and it works quite well as a medium-large-capacity BBQ (does 50-75 pounds of ribs very well in a batch). WebAug 12, 2024 · The standard brickwork coordinating size is 225 mm x 112.5 mm x 75 mm (length x depth x height). It comprises 10 mm mortar joints, making the normal brick dimension 215 mm x 102.5 mm x 65 mm (length x depth x height).
